  • This video explains how our threaded and sliding (“Instadjust” / click-stop and twist-lock) eyeguards work. These are found on all DeLite, Delos, Nagler T4 and 41 Panoptic, & 55 Plössl eyepieces. Learn how to see the full field in comfort. The answer is presented by David Nagler.
    This video originally aired as part of the Northeast Astronomy Forum (NEAF) and Space Expo 2021 Virtual Experience on April 10, 2021.

    2021 Virtual NEAF: Your Questions Answered with Al and David Nagler
    Due to the continuing COVID-19 crises, the Northeast Astronomy Forum (NEAF) - “the World’s Largest Astronomy & Space Expo” - was a “virtual,” online-only affair for 2021. However, that is not all bad: it allows people from around the world - who might normally not travel to New York - to experience this special show.
    On our blog, before the show, we asked for your Tele Vue product questions which would be answered on videos and played at the virtual NEAF on April 10, 2021. The response was tremendous! Though time and slots were limited, we were able to produce seven videos for the show. Each video provides a “front-row” seat to the answer from David and Al Nagler.
